World Wetlands Day 2021: Sundarbans, Danube Delta, Kakadu National Park & Other Famous Wetlands Around the World
Wetlands, a part of our planet, is an essential habitat for human and numerous creatures on earth. “Wetlands and water” is the theme for WWD 2021. The event is an environmentally-related celebration which dates back to the year of 1971. Let us look at some of the most famous and important wetlands around the world.
